WebIf the potential energy function U (x) is known, then the force at any position can be obtained by taking the derivative of the potential. (2.5.1) F x = − d U d x. Graphically, this means that if we have potential energy vs. position, the force is the negative of the slope of the function at some point. (2.5.2) F = − ( s l o p e) The minus ... WebElectric Potential Difference. The electric potential difference between points A and B, V B − V A, is defined to be the change in potential energy of a charge q moved from A to B, divided by the charge. Units of potential difference are joules per coulomb, given the name volt (V) after Alessandro Volta. 1 V = 1 J/C. WebWater potential is the potential energy of water per unit volume relative to pure water in reference conditions. A ball that you hold in your … Web12 de set. de 2024 · ΔU = − ∫r2r1→F ⋅ d→r = GMEm∫r2r1dr r2 = GMEm( 1 r1 − 1 r2). Since ΔU = U2 − U1 we can adopt a simple expression for U: U = − GMEm r. Note two important items with this definition. First, U → 0 as r → ∞. The potential energy is zero when the two masses are infinitely far apart.
